## Catalogue Import — Quick Orientation

When a branch library sends a catalogue file, the Shelfwright importer picks it up overnight and merges records into the main index. Most support tickets are just malformed MARC exports — bounce those back with the formatting guide. If you need to force a manual import, the uploaded bundle has to be signed or the ingest service rejects it outright. Use the signing key below for manual runs.

signing key of bagap-yawep = bky13_TbfT6ZMUoGJo2

## Connection Pool Limits

Every service at Tidemark that talks to the Orrery cluster must go through the shared pooling layer. Exceeding your pool allocation degrades neighbors on the same proxy, so treat these numbers as hard budgets, not suggestions. Requests for larger pools go through the platform review board with a load test attached. The current default constants, applied unless your service has an approved override, are as follows.

limits module of fajog-tawig:
RATE_LIMITS = {
    "druwyn": 2,
    "quenael": 10,
    "wenix": 2,
    "druael": 2,
}

## Authentication

The Crumbline order service enforces a hard cutoff: orders placed after 14:00 local time are scheduled for next-day baking, and the API rejects same-day requests past that hour. All calls to the cutoff-evaluation endpoint must be authenticated, since the schedule feed is internal to Marrow & Rye Bakehouse. Contractors use the shared staging credential rather than personal tokens. For local development, authenticate with the key shown below.

gateway credential: kto7_GoY89Me